• Represa de Agua

    address

    Pueblo Achuar y Av. del Bombero, Cuenca 010109
    Ecuador

    Discover
  • Purificadora 21

    address

    Pueblo Achuar y Av. del Bombero, Cuenca 010109
    Ecuador

    Discover
  • THE ACADEMIC BIRD

    address

    PORTOVIEJO
    Ecuador

    Discover
  • ROBOT DE EMERGENCIA HIPOCRATITO

    address

    PORTOVIEJO
    Ecuador

    Discover
  • Ocean Litter Collector

    address

    Portoviejo
    Ecuador

    Discover